Environmental noise is a common aspect of modern life, originating from sources such as traffic, construction, household appliances, and crowded public spaces. While some noise can be tolerable or even beneficial in certain contexts, excessive or unpredictable noise can negatively affect our ability to focus and concentrate.
The Effects of Noise on Attention and Concentration
Research shows that high levels of environmental noise can impair cognitive functions, especially attention span and concentration. When noise levels are loud or unpredictable, the brain works harder to filter out distractions, which can lead to mental fatigue and decreased productivity.
How Noise Disrupts Focus
Environmental noise can interfere with focus in several ways:
- Diverts attention: Sudden or loud sounds can break concentration, forcing the brain to switch focus.
- Increases stress levels: Persistent noise can raise cortisol levels, which negatively impacts cognitive performance.
- Reduces information retention: Background noise hampers the brain’s ability to encode and recall information effectively.
Strategies to Minimize Noise Distractions
To improve concentration in noisy environments, consider implementing the following strategies:
- Use noise-canceling headphones: These help block out background sounds and create a more focused environment.
- Designate quiet spaces: Allocate specific areas for studying or work that are away from noise sources.
- Sound masking: Use white noise machines or calming background sounds to drown out disruptive noises.
- Time management: Schedule demanding tasks during quieter times of the day.
